Hi all,

As part of the Fennelworks platform reshuffle, ownership of webhook delivery retry semantics is moving out of the Core Transport group. This covers the exponential backoff schedule, the dead-letter queue after eight failed attempts, idempotency key handling, and the per-endpoint circuit breaker. Please route any design questions, incident escalations, or proposed changes to the retry configuration through the new owner rather than the old alias, effective Monday. Going forward, the responsible engineer is listed below.

account owner for bawip-tahag: Raleth Quenok

### Changed defaults: contrast audit

Following the Brightmoor accessibility audit, the Wrenfold UI kit now defaults to the high-contrast palette, and the build fails on any component below a 4.5:1 ratio instead of just warning. Release managers: this may block a couple of legacy dashboards, so check the audit report first. The theming service now ships with these defaults.

service settings:
novath:
  pin: 1396
  tenant: pelys
  seal: seal_ccc035e1
  metrics_host: metrics.novath.qorvelworks.test
  standby_team: fraeth
  escalation: drueth-zorok
  nonce: 61d508

## Step 4: Migrate the grid engine

Gridsmith's new solver replaces the old Puzzlark backtracker. Delete the legacy wordlist cache before first run or fills will be inconsistent. Symmetry enforcement is now config-driven, not hardcoded. Run the smoke suite against the sample 15x15 grids and confirm fill times stay under two seconds. Start the solver with the configuration shown below.

deployment values, kajep-kageg:
[praix]
host = praix.paliqcorp.corp
user = praix_svc
database = praix_prod

TICKET: SQLINT-412 — Rule pack signature check failing in CI

For the eng sync: the Grindlewick SQL linter refuses to load our custom rule pack because the pack's signature no longer matches after last week's key rotation. All pipelines touching migrations are blocked at the lint stage. The fix is to re-sign the rule pack with the current key and push it to the shared config repo. No rule content changed. The current signing key follows below.

deploy key for tahof-yadup: bky6_JWeaJq